Step-by-Step Instructions
Transforming everyday materials into creative candle holders can be a fun and rewarding project for Thanksgiving. Start by gathering items like mason jars, twine, and leaves.
Clean the jars and wrap twine around their necks, securing it with a bow for a rustic touch. Next, glue dried leaves around the jar for a seasonal flair. Place a tealight candle inside.
As you light them, you'll evoke warm holiday memories, enhancing your Thanksgiving traditions. For an extra twist, paint the jars with autumn colors or add glitter to capture the light beautifully.

Natural Materials Inspiration
Embrace the beauty of nature by incorporating rustic elements into your Thanksgiving table settings.
Start with a tablecloth in nature-inspired colors like deep browns, burnt oranges, and muted greens that evoke the changing leaves. Layer in seasonal textures—think burlap runners or woven placemats—to create an inviting atmosphere.
Use wooden chargers under your plates, and opt for mismatched ceramic dishes for a charming, eclectic feel. Scatter pinecones, acorns, and small gourds down the center of your table as natural accents that celebrate the harvest.
Finally, light up the scene with mason jar candles filled with autumn spices. Your guests will appreciate the warmth and creativity, making your Thanksgiving celebration truly memorable.

Simple Centerpiece Ideas
A stunning centerpiece can elevate your rustic Thanksgiving table and set the tone for the entire celebration. Start with a wooden tray or a vintage crate as your base. Fill it with seasonal elements like mini pumpkins, pinecones, and vibrant leaves in rich Thanksgiving colors like deep oranges, burgundies, and earthy greens.
For added warmth, incorporate candles of varying heights to create a cozy glow. Consider using a simple floral arrangement with wildflowers or dried grasses for a natural touch.
Don't forget to balance your table arrangement—keep the centerpiece low enough for easy conversation while ensuring it draws the eye. This mix of textures and colors will make your table not just beautiful, but also inviting and full of life.

How Long Do Thanksgiving Crafts Typically Last?
Thanksgiving decorations can vary in craft longevity, depending on the materials you use.
If you opt for durable items like wood or high-quality fabrics, you'll find they can last for years.
However, more delicate crafts, like paper or natural elements, might only hold up for the season.
You'll want to contemplate your desired longevity when creating, so you can enjoy your festive touches long after the turkey's been served.
